## Changelog — ProctorLine Queue v4.2

We changed several defaults in the exam-proctoring queue after the Hallowmere pilot showed reviewers falling behind during peak sittings. Idle sessions now requeue after a shorter timeout, escalation to a senior proctor happens automatically on the second flag, and batch size for review assignment was reduced to smooth load. Please review these before Thursday's rollout. The new default configuration shipped with this release is as follows.

service settings:
[casax]
port = 6379
team = rusir
host = casax.zemvarhq.corp
region = outer-4
access_code = ac_9808ce
timeout_ms = 1500

**Ticket: BounceHawk config drift on prod-3**

Priority: High. Assign: on-call.

BounceHawk's email bounce processor on prod-3 diverged from the baked image sometime after Tuesday's hotfix. Retry backoff and suppression-list TTL no longer match prod-1/prod-2. Symptom: duplicate bounce notifications hitting the Marwick queue. Someone likely patched values live during the incident and never committed them. Do not restart until values are captured; a restart wipes the overlay. Current effective configuration on prod-3 is as follows.

service settings:
PRAIX_LOG_LEVEL=error
PRAIX_METRICS_HOST=metrics.praix.qorvelcorp.corp
PRAIX_POOL_SIZE=16

**Ticket #4471 — Deep links bouncing to the fallback web page**

New folks, welcome to your first env mystery. Hopscotch's deep-link router on staging keeps dumping users onto the fallback page instead of opening the app. Turns out the staging env file was copied from an old template and the link-verification credential never got filled in, so the resolver silently fails closed. The fix is simple: open `staging.env`, scroll to the routing section, and add the line below:

sealed setting: ARCHIVE_KEY3=8d0

= Support Outsourcing Plan (Managers Only) =

Quick update for branch managers: we're moving tier-1 customer support for the Lanternby product range to an external partner, Fenwick Response, starting next quarter. Tier-2 stays in-house. Expect a short handover period with some rough edges — flag issues through the usual channel, not to customers. The confidential reasoning behind the move is summarised below.

internal memo for bahap-yagug: Headcount on the Ulaix team goes from 3 to 100 by the end of January. Gross margin on Ulaix came in at 10 percent against a plan of 15 percent.